Stop!Block!Tell!

3 RULES TO REMEMBER

STOP! If you see something that you think you should not be looking at then just STOP!

Do not keep goingTurn off your monitor

or shut your laptopAsk for help

Tell!If you see something bad,

close the computer!

Immediately call the teacher to your computer!

Seeing something bad does not make you a bad

student!

McGruff’s Internet Safety Pledge Check each promise and sign your name at the bottom. Then put it by your computer so you’ll always remember how to stay cyber-safe! I PROMISE:Never to give out my name, address, phone number, school name, any adult’s credit card number to anyone online. Never to arrange a face-to-face meeting with anyone I meet online. Never to go into chat rooms unless my parents say it’s okay. Never to open emails from someone I don’t know and never to go to links I don’t recognize. Always to tell an adult if I see anything online that makes me feel uncomfortable.
